Output dbaa05f3f5fec8b79be618ea8a5b22ed128688d71d03dfbb37b1d96e4429349e:0

value
1072668
script pubkey
OP_0 OP_PUSHBYTES_20 e83e3601fa0939a065a743ac8b84f0d995ee4f92
address
bc1qaqlrvq06pyu6qed8gwkghp8smx27unuj3sh5hw
transaction
dbaa05f3f5fec8b79be618ea8a5b22ed128688d71d03dfbb37b1d96e4429349e
confirmations
142350
spent
true